您的位置:首页 > 移动开发 > 微信开发

微信小程序-隐藏和显示自定义的导航

2017-06-13 14:44 846 查看
微信小程序中不能直接操作window对象,document文档,跟html的树结构不相同。

实现类似导航的隐藏显示,如图效果:

// index.js

var statusArrs = [false]

Page({

/**
* 页面的初始数据
*/
data: {
showArr: statusArrs
},
opentype: function (e) {
var url = e.currentTarget.dataset.url
url = '../' + url
wx.navigateTo({
url: url
})
},
//显示隐藏
tigger: function (e) {
var that = this;
var num = e.currentTarget.dataset.num
statusArrs[num] = !statusArrs[num]
that.setData({
showArr: statusArrs
})
}
})


View Code
方法二这种方式就简单实现了不修改js代码,添加了新的view也能控制隐藏显示。

一点小技巧分享。
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: